Sokol Gymnastics Association is a multi-generational fitness, educational, cultural, and social organization that was founded in 1862 in the Czech Republic and has since established a strong presence in the United States. With six Districts across the nation and various Units tailored to different locations, Sokol offers a wide range of programs including artistic and rhythmic gymnastics, volleyball, folk dancing, camping, track & field, martial arts, and more. The organization is dedicated to promoting physical fitness, educational and cultural enrichment, and social activities for individuals of all backgrounds.

Sokol’s philosophy is rooted in the belief that physical fitness is essential for everyone, regardless of age, gender, athletic ability, cultural background, or occupation.

With a commitment to the advancement of its members and the local community, Sokol strives to promote physical well-being, mental alertness, and personal development. Through a diverse array of programs and activities, Sokol aims to cultivate physically fit, mentally sharp, and well-rounded individuals who contribute to the creation of a healthy and robust society. The organization’s motto, “Physical perfection joined with a noble mind, is not just a slogan, it is a way of life,” reflects its core values and dedication to holistic growth and well-being.
